Oliver Tree, the musician recognized for his songs "Life Goes On" and "Alien Boy," died in a helicopter crash in Rio de Janeiro on Sunday morning. He was 32 years old. The incident, which involved two helicopters, occurred in the Southwest region of Rio de Janeiro. CNN Brazil reported the news, citing local authorities. Tree, whose real name was Oliver Tree Nickell, was a California-born artist who gained popularity for his genre-bending music and distinctive visual style. His career began to gain significant traction in the late 2010s with the release of his debut album, "Ugly Is Beautiful," in 2020. The album featured hit singles that resonated with a wide audience, establishing him as a notable figure in contemporary music. Prior to his death, Tree had been actively touring and releasing new material, engaging with his fanbase through various platforms. His passing marks a significant loss to the music industry, with many fans and fellow artists expressing their condolences online.
